I'm against this -- less dependencies is better. As an
example, on IRIX the version of sdl distributed with
'freeware' links to aalib ... do we really want to insist
that people have an ascii art library installed in order
to run blender? Similarly, blender doesn't use ogg vorbis,
so why insist users have it installed?
I say either build without openal, or build your
own openal (which is how I build blender).
